Định tuyến tĩnh là gì

Nhỏng bọn họ đã biết, router tiến hành việc định tuyến phụ thuộc một giải pháp Gọi là bảng định tuyến đường (routing table). Nguyên ổn tắc là đều gói tin IP lúc đi mang đến router đang phần lớn được tra bảng định tuyến đường, nếu như đích đến của gói tin trực thuộc về một entry bao gồm vào bảng định tuyến đường thì gói tin sẽ được gửi đi tiếp, nếu không, gói tin đã bị loại bỏ vứt. Bảng định đường bên trên router biểu đạt ra rằng router biết được bây giờ có những subnet như thế nào đã tồn tại bên trên mạng nhưng nó tmê say gia cùng ao ước mang lại được hồ hết subnet ấy thì nên theo con đường như thế nào.

Bạn đang xem: Định tuyến tĩnh là gì

Để làm rõ vụ việc, ta thuộc để ý ví dụ 1:

*

Hình 1 – Sơ đồ ví dụ 1.

Trên hình 1 là nhì router đại diện thay mặt đến nhị chi nhánh khác nhau của một doanh nghiệp: R1 mang lại chi nhánh 1 cùng R2 mang đến chi nhánh 2. R1 sử dụng cổng f0/0 của nó đấu xuống mạng LAN của chi nhánh 1, mạng này sử dụng subnet 192.168.1.0/24. Tương từ, R2 sử dụng cổng f0/0 của nó đấu xuống mạng LAN của Trụ sở 2, mạng này thực hiện subnet 192.168.2.0/24. Subnet sử dụng đến kết nối leased – line nối thân nhị Trụ sở (qua các cổng serial của nhì router) là 192.168.12.0/30.

Mặc định lúc đầu, Lúc ta không cấu hình định đường bên trên những router R1 với R2 thì nhị mạng LAN của hai Trụ sở R1 với R2 không thể đi mang đến nhau được (có nghĩa là, trường hợp lấy một PC vào LAN 1, ví dụ như PC1 ping test cho một PC vào LAN 2, ví dụ PC4, ping sẽ không thành công). Lý vì chưng của điều đó là những router R1 và R2 chưa xuất hiện thông tin về những mạng LAN của nhau trong bảng định con đường cho nên vì vậy chẳng thể chuyển gói tin đi cho các mạng LAN này. Ta bình chọn bằng cách hiển thị bảng định tuyến đường trên những router R1 cùng R2. Câu lệnh nhằm hiển thị bảng định tuyến trên router là ‘show ip route’:

Bảng định tuyến đường của R1:

R1#show ip route

Gateway of last resort is not set

192.168.12.0/30 is subnetted, 1 subnets

C 192.168.12.0 isdirectly connected,Serial2/0

C 192.168.1.0/24 isdirectly connected,FastEthernet0/0

Bảng định tuyến của R2:

R2#show ip route

(đã loại trừ một số trong những dòng)

Gateway of last resort is not set

192.168.12.0/30 is subnetted, 1 subnets

C 192.168.12.0is directly connected,Serial2/0

C 192.168.2.0/24is directly connected,FastEthernet0/0

Từ hiệu quả hiển thị, ta thấy rằng từng router ban đầu chỉ học được thông tin về đều subnet kết nối thẳng cùng với nó. Ví dụ: router R1 biết rằng có mạng 192.168.12.0/30 liên kết thẳng vào cổng serial 2/0 và mạng 192.168.1.0/24 liên kết thẳng vào cổng fast ethernet 0/0 của nó. Các router trọn vẹn không có thông tin gì về những subnet ở xa, ko kết nối trực tiếp cùng với bản thân. Do kia, đưa sử PC1 ao ước ping PC4, nó vẫn đóng gói một gói tin IPhường ICMPhường. cùng với liên hệ mối cung cấp là 192.168.1.1 với đích mang đến là 192.168.2.2. Lúc gói tin này đi lên đến router R1, R1 tra bảng định tuyến đường thấy rằng đích cho 192.168.2.2 ko nằm trong về ngẫu nhiên subnet làm sao cơ mà R1 có vào bảng định tuyến đường nên nó drop quăng quật gói tin này.

Vậy nhằm nhì mạng 192.168.1.0/24 cùng 192.168.2.0/24 hoàn toàn có thể đi mang đến nhau được, các router yêu cầu điền được lên tiếng về hai mạng này vào vào bảng định đường của chính mình. Có hai phương pháp nhằm triển khai điều đó: một là tín đồ quản ngại trị tự điền tay những công bố – định tuyến đường tĩnh, hai là các router từ thương lượng công bố định tuyến cùng nhau và từ điền những lên tiếng không đủ vào bảng định con đường của bản thân – định đường cồn. Tại phía trên ta điều tra biện pháp tiến hành là định tuyến đường tĩnh.

Việc cấu hình định con đường tĩnh trên router Cisteo được thực hiện bằng phương pháp thực hiện lệnh tất cả cú pháp nhỏng sau:

Router(config)#ip routedestination_subnetsubnetmaskIP_next_hop <AD>

Trong đó:

destination_subnet: mạng đích mang lại.

Subnetmask: subnet – mask của mạng đích.

IP_next_hop: xúc tiến IPhường của trạm tiếp đến trên tuyến đường đi.

output_interface: cổng ra bên trên router.

AD: chỉ số AD của route khai báo, sử dụng vào ngôi trường vừa lòng gồm cấu hình dự trữ.

Cụ thể vào ví dụ này:

Từ R1 muốn đi mang đến mạng 192.168.2.0/24 , ta buộc phải đi thoát khỏi cổng s2/0. Để miêu tả điều đó vào bảng định con đường, ta tiến hành cấu hình:

R1(config)#ip route 192.168.2.0 255.255.255.0 s2/0

Tương trường đoản cú, Từ R2 muốn đi mang lại mạng 192.168.1.0/24 , ta phải đi thoát khỏi cổng s2/0. Cấu hình:

R2(config)#ip route 192.168.1.0 255.255.255.0 s2/0

Sau Lúc vẫn thông số kỹ thuật chấm dứt những route cho những mạng 192.168.1.0/24 và 192.168.2.0/24, ta thực hiện chất vấn bằng cách hiển thị bảng định tuyến bên trên mỗi router:

Bảng định con đường của R1:

R1#show ip route

Gateway of last resort is not set

192.168.12.0/30 is subnetted, 1 subnets

C 192.168.12.0 is directly connected, Serial2/0

C 192.168.1.0/24 is directly connected, FastEthernet0/0

S 192.168.2.0/24 is directly connected, Serial2/0

Bảng định con đường của R2:

R2#show ip route

Gateway of last resort is not set

192.168.12.0/30 is subnetted, 1 subnets

C 192.168.12.0 is directly connected, Serial2/0

S 192.168.1.0/24 is directly connected, Serial2/0

C 192.168.2.0/24 is directly connected, FastEthernet0/0

Ta thấy rằng những thông báo không đủ trước đó đang lộ diện trong bảng định đường của những router R1 với R2. Các entry bắt đầu điền thêm này được cam kết hiện vày kí tự “S” ngơi nghỉ đầu loại bộc lộ rằng các thông tin định đường này được học tập vào bảng định con đường thông qua định đường tĩnh ( ta cũng để ý rằng những dòng mô tả các mạng liên kết trực tiếp được ký kết hiệu vì chưng kí tự “C” – connected – liên kết trực tiếp).

khi các PC đang chỉ mặc định – gateway khá đầy đủ lên những cổng đấu nối của các router, ping đánh giá thân những PC ở trong hai mạng LAN vẫn thành công:

*

Hình 2 – Ping kiểm soát giữa PC1 cùng PC4 từ PC1.

Bên cạnh việc đi đường bằng cổng ra (output interface), ta cũng có thể dẫn đường vào câu lệnh bằng tác động IPhường next – hop, trên đây chính là liên can IPhường của trạm kế tiếp trên tuyến đường đi cho mạng đích.

Xem thêm: Tìm Hiểu Hệ Điều Hành Tizen Là Gì, Có Gì Đặc Sắc? Hệ Điều Hành Tizen Os Trên Tivi Samsung Là Gì

Trên R1:

R1(config)#ip route 192.168.2.0 255.255.255.0 192.168.12.2

Trên R2:

R2(config)#ip route 192.168.1.0 255.255.255.0 192.168.12.1

Nlỗi ta đã thấy bên trên hình 1, tự R1 mong mỏi đi đến mạng 192.168.2.0/24 thì buộc phải đi qua trạm sau đó là R2 có xúc tiến IP là 192.168.12.2 và từ bỏ R2 mong muốn đi đến mạng 192.168.1.0/24 thì đề nghị trải qua trạm kế tiếp là R1 tất cả liên hệ IPhường là 192.168.12.1.

Hai phong cách thông số kỹ thuật này còn có chức năng tương đồng, điểm khác hoàn toàn là route static được knhì báo theo phong cách output – interface sẽ sở hữu được AD = 0 còn route static được knhì báo theo kiểu IPhường. next – hop sẽ có AD = 1. Hình như trường hợp cổng ra là một trong những cổng multi – access thì ta phải áp dụng kiểu dáng knhì báo IP next – hop (sự việc này sẽ được đề cập với phân tích và lý giải cụ thể vào một bài viết khác).

Ví dụ bên trên đây vẫn biểu lộ một phương pháp cơ bạn dạng độc nhất vô nhị biện pháp knhì báo static route bên trên những router. Tiếp theo, ta cùng khảo sát điều tra một ví dụ khác phức tạp rộng, sơ thứ lần này sẽ sở hữu được 03 router:

*

Hình 3 – Sơ đồ dùng ví dụ 2.

Yêu cầu đề ra là thông số kỹ thuật định tuyến tĩnh trên những router bảo đảm đến hầu như can dự bên trên sơ thiết bị thấy nhau.

Tương từ như ví dụ 1, trên từng router ta đang thực hiện điền biết tin về các subnet ko kết nối thẳng vào bảng định con đường của mỗi router thực hiện câu lệnh câu hình static route:

Trên R1:

R1(config)#ip route 192.168.2.0 255.255.255.0 s2/0

R1(config)#ip route 192.168.23.0 255.255.255.0 s2/0

R1(config)#ip route 192.168.3.0 255.255.255.0 s2/0

Trên R2:

R2(config)#ip route 192.168.1.0 255.255.255.0 s2/0

R2(config)#ip route 192.168.3.0 255.255.255.0 s2/1

Trên R3:

R1(config)#ip route 192.168.1.0 255.255.255.0 s2/1

R1(config)#ip route 192.168.12.0 255.255.255.0 s2/1

R1(config)#ip route 192.168.2.0 255.255.255.0 s2/1

Lưu ý rằng chúng ta buộc phải điền rất đầy đủ ban bố định con đường trên toàn bộ những router, vị trường hợp như chỉ cần một router nào đó trên phố đi của gói tin bị thiếu thốn route, gói tin sẽ bị drop giữa đường. Chẳng hạn, đưa sử ta quên cấu hình chỉ đường đi mang lại mạng 192.168.3.0/24 trên R2. Gói tin xuất phát từ mạng 192.168.1.0/24 đi cho mạng 192.168.3.0/24 lúc đi mang lại R1 sẽ được chuyến qua qua cổng s2/0 để đi tiếp (bởi vì điều đó đã có chỉ ra vào cấu hình định tuyến tĩnh của R1), tuy vậy khi đi cho R2 nó sẽ bị drop bỏ vì R2 thiếu lên tiếng của mạng 192.168.3.0/24.

Ta thuộc cẩn thận tiếp ví dụ vật dụng 3 về cấu hình con đường dự phòng trong những số đó có áp dụng đến tyêu thích số AD vào câu lệnh cấu hình:

*

Hình 4 – Sơ thứ ví dụ 3.

Lần này hưởng thụ đề ra nlỗi sau: thông số kỹ thuật định con đường tĩnh đảm bảo an toàn R1 đi đến LAN 2 của R2 theo đường đi ra cổng s2/0 là bao gồm, con đường s2/1 là dự phòng, trở lại, R2 lại đi đến LAN 1 của R1 theo đường đi ra cổng s2/một là chính, con đường s2/0 là dự phòng. Có nghĩa là, R1 Khi đưa gói tin đi LAN 2 của R2 luôn luôn thực hiện cổng ra là s2/0, Lúc cổng s2/0 này down thì tự động hóa gửi mặt đường qua s2/1, khi cổng s2/0 up lại, lại gửi về sử dụng cổng s2/0. Tương tự cùng với R2.

Để tiến hành từng trải này, họ thực hiện tsay đắm số AD trong câu lệnh thông số kỹ thuật định tuyến đường tĩnh. Như sẽ nói, static route rất có thể gồm nhì chỉ số AD là 0 (Khi thông số kỹ thuật chỉ cổng ra) cùng 1 (khi thông số kỹ thuật chỉ next – hop). Ta rất có thể biến đổi các giá trị mang định này nhằm giao hàng mang đến câu hỏi thông số kỹ thuật dự trữ.

Nhắc lại rằng AD dùng để đối chiếu độ ưu tiên giữa các route. Lúc trường tồn các lối đi mang đến cùng một đích cho, mặt đường đi nhé có chỉ số AD bé dại rộng, đường đi kia sẽ được đưa vào bảng định tuyến đường nhằm áp dụng, đông đảo đường sót lại bao gồm AD cao hơn sẽ được cần sử dụng để tham dự phòng mang lại mặt đường chính thức. Do kia ta chỉ câu hỏi chọn AD bé dại hơn (ví dụ là 5) mang lại con đường chủ yếu cùng lựa chọn AD lớn hơn (ví dụ là 10) cho con đường prúc.

Cấu hình trên R1:

R1(config)#ip route 192.168.2.0 255.255.255.0Serial2/0 5

R1(config)#ip route 192.168.2.0 255.255.255.0Serial2/1 10

Cấu hình trên R2:

R2(config)#ip route 192.168.1.0 255.255.255.0Serial2/1 5

R2(config)#ip route 192.168.1.0 255.255.255.0Serial2/0 10

Ta tiến hành chất vấn hiệu quả cấu hình bên trên R1:

Đầu tiên, ta hiển thị bảng định tuyến đường để thấy mặt đường làm sao đã được đưa vào bảng:

R1#show ip route

192.168.12.0/30 is subnetted, 1 subnets

C 192.168.12.0 is directly connected, Serial2/0

192.168.21.0/30 is subnetted, 1 subnets

C 192.168.21.0 is directly connected, Serial2/1

C 192.168.1.0/24 is directly connected, FastEthernet0/0

S 192.168.2.0/24 is directly connected, Serial2/0

Ta thấy mặt đường được chuyển vào bảng định tuyến đường để thực hiện có cổng ra là s2/0 đúng thật kinh nghiệm.

Tiếp theo ta demo tính dự phòng bằng cách shutdown cổng s2/0 của R1:

R1(config)#interface s2/0

R1(config-if)#shutdown

R1(config-if)#

*Mar 1 00:15:48.971: %LINK-5-CHANGED: Interface Serial2/0, changed state to lớn administratively down

*Mar 1 00:15:49.971: %LINEPROTO-5-UPDOWN: Line protocol on Interface Serial2/0, changed state lớn down

Đường chính đã không còn, ta hiển thị lại bảng định tuyến đường để chắc chắn rằng con đường prúc (rời khỏi cổng s2/1) đã có được đưa vào bảng định tuyến:

R1#show ip route

192.168.12.0/30 is subnetted, 1 subnets

C 192.168.12.0 is directly connected, Serial2/0

192.168.21.0/30 is subnetted, 1 subnets

C 192.168.21.0 is directly connected, Serial2/1

C 192.168.1.0/24 is directly connected, FastEthernet0/0

S 192.168.2.0/24 is directly connected, Serial2/1

Ta tiến hành mngơi nghỉ lại cổng s2/0 với soát sổ rằng con đường đi qua cổng đó lại được chuyển lại vào bảng định đường để sử dụng:

R1(config)#interface s2/0

R1(config-if)#no shutdown

R1(config-if)#

*Mar 1 00:19:36.767: %LINK-3-UPDOWN: Interface Serial2/0, changed state khổng lồ up

R1(config-if)#

*Mar 1 00:19:37.775: %LINEPROTO-5-UPDOWN: Line protocol on Interface Serial2/0, changed state to up

R1#show ip route

192.168.12.0/30 is subnetted, 1 subnets

C 192.168.12.0 is directly connected, Serial2/0

192.168.21.0/30 is subnetted, 1 subnets

C 192.168.21.0 is directly connected, Serial2/1

C 192.168.1.0/24 is directly connected, FastEthernet0/0

S 192.168.2.0/24 is directly connected, Serial2/0

Thực hiện tại soát sổ giống như bên trên R2.

Nhìn phổ biến, định tuyến tĩnh bao gồm ưu điểm là khá dễ nắm bắt với cũng dễ dàng cấu hình. Thêm nữa, định tuyến tĩnh còn tồn tại một điểm mạnh không giống là không khiến hao tốn tài nguyên mạng vày không có sự trao đổi biết tin định tuyến thân những router. Tuy nhiên điểm yếu của định con đường tĩnh là trọn vẹn không đam mê phù hợp với hầu hết mạng bao gồm đồ sộ to (ta cấp thiết thông số kỹ thuật tay knhì báo các route Khi số lượng lên đến mức hàng nghìn được!) với không quy tụ với mọi sự biến đổi trên sơ thứ mạng Lúc nhưng cổng ra vẫn sống tâm lý up/up. Để hạn chế và khắc phục những nhược điểm này, bọn họ bắt buộc thực hiện định đường cồn bằng phương pháp chạy một giao thức định đường làm sao kia.